data SymbolEnv = SymbolEnv
    { uniq    :: {-# UNPACK #-} !Int
    , symbols :: !(Map.Map String Symbol)
    }

symbolEnv :: MVar SymbolEnv
{-# NOINLINE symbolEnv #-}
symbolEnv = unsafePerformIO $ newMVar $ SymbolEnv 1 Map.empty

-- We @'deepseq' s@ so that we can guarantee that when we perform the lookup we
-- won't potentially have to evaluate a thunk that might itself call @'intern'@,
-- leading to a deadlock.

-- |Intern a string to produce a 'Symbol'.
intern :: String -> Symbol
{-# NOINLINE intern #-}
intern s = s `deepseq` unsafePerformIO $ modifyMVar symbolEnv $ \env -> do
    case Map.lookup s (symbols env) of
      Nothing  -> do let sym  = Symbol (uniq env) s
                     let env' = env { uniq    = uniq env + 1,
                                      symbols = Map.insert s sym
                                                (symbols env)
                                    }
                     env' `seq` return (env', sym)
      Just sym -> return (env, sym)

-- |Return the 'String' associated with a 'Symbol'.
unintern :: Symbol -> String
unintern (Symbol _ s) = s
